Drake Reveals First Single From "Take Care"


Producers Matthew "Boi-1da" Samuels and Noah "40" Shebib man the boards for the project's first offering.

Drake has been tossing out new tracks over the past few weeks, including "Marvin's Room" and "Dreams Money Can Buy." Now, the Young Money rapper is gearing up to release the first official single off his sophomore album Take Care, dropping October 24th.

"Headlines," produced by frequent collaborators Matthew "Boi-1da" Samuels and Noah "40" Shebib, serves as the first single, which Drake promised would arrive in a few weeks earlier this month. The Toronto, Canada native hinted at the title in a tweet, later revealed by Serm Knight and confirmed by producers Chase N Cashe (via HHNM).
